What are plate carriers and their purpose?
A plate carrier is a specialized piece of tactical gear designed to hold ballistic plates, primarily ceramic or polyethylene, that protect the wearer's vital organs from rifle fire and fragmentation. Unlike older, bulkier tactical vests, modern plate carriers are modular and lightweight, focusing on protecting the torso's front, back, and sides while allowing for the attachment of additional equipment via MOLLE (Modular Lightweight Load-carrying Equipment) webbing. Their purpose extends beyond military applications; they are essential for law enforcement officers, security personnel, and even civilians engaged in high-risk activities or training. The core philosophy is to provide critical, life-saving protection while maximizing mobility and mission-specific customization.
The role of Velcro patches on plate carriers
Velcro patches, specifically the hook-and-loop fastener system, have become an integral part of the plate carrier ecosystem. They serve multiple critical functions that enhance both operational effectiveness and safety. Primarily, they provide a swift and secure method for identification. In high-stress, low-visibility, or chaotic environments, being able to instantly identify a team member, their role, or their medical status can be the difference between life and death. The Velcro panels, often referred to as "morale panels" or "ID panels," offer a flat, standardized surface on the front, back, and sometimes shoulders of the carrier. This allows for the rapid swapping of information without altering the carrier's structure. For instance, switching from a daytime identification patch to a highly reflective one for night operations takes seconds. This modularity is why custom velcro patches for plate carrier systems are so valued—they turn a generic piece of protective equipment into a personalized, mission-ready tool.

Identification Patches: Name, rank, and unit insignia
This is the most fundamental and critical category. Identification patches provide immediate visual recognition of the wearer. A standard setup includes a last name and blood type on the front, and a full name, rank, and unit insignia on the back. This allows for identification from both angles, which is vital in team movements and casualty situations. For law enforcement in Hong Kong, these patches might also include a regimental number or a specific unit designation like "SDU" (Special Duties Unit). The design must prioritize clarity: high-contrast colors, bold, sans-serif fonts, and standardized sizing. These are the quintessential custom velcro patches for tactical vest that move beyond personalization into the realm of essential operational gear. They ensure seamless integration within a command structure and are often the first visual cue in establishing authority and coordination in the field.
Medical Patches: Indicating medical conditions or needs
Medical patches are life-saving tools. They convey critical health information when the wearer may be incapacitated and unable to communicate. Common elements include:
- Blood Type: Crucial for rapid transfusion in emergency trauma care.
- Allergies: Especially to medications like penicillin or common analgesics.
- Medical Conditions: Such as diabetes, epilepsy, or heart conditions.
- Medical Qualifications: A "MEDIC" or "PARAMEDIC" patch instantly identifies trained personnel in a casualty scenario.
Reflective Patches: Enhancing visibility in low-light conditions
Reflective patches serve a dual purpose: enhancing safety during low-light or night operations and providing positive identification under night vision or infrared illumination. They are made with micro-prismatic or glass-bead reflective materials that bounce light back to its source. For law enforcement conducting vehicle checkpoints at night or security personnel on patrol, these patches make the wearer visible to colleagues and civilians, preventing friendly fire or accidental collisions. Some advanced patches are designed to be "IR compliant," meaning they reflect infrared light used by night vision devices, allowing for silent visual identification. The design often incorporates reflective material into the border or specific elements of an identification patch, ensuring functionality without compromising daytime appearance.

Choosing the right size and shape
The size and shape of your patch are dictated by the Velcro panel on your plate carrier and its intended function. Standard panel sizes are often 2" x 3", 3" x 5", or larger for back panels. Your patch should fit within this area with a small border. Common shapes include rectangle, square, circle, and oval. Die-cut shapes (custom shapes like shields, stars, or skulls) are popular for morale and custom-designed patches but may reduce the usable space for text on identification patches. A key consideration is standardization across a team; having all ID patches the same size and shape creates a professional, uniform appearance. Always check your gear's specifications before finalizing a design.
Selecting appropriate colors and fonts
Color and font choice directly impact readability and professionalism. For identification patches, high-contrast combinations are non-negotiable. The most effective and traditional is black background with white text (or subdued colors like OD Green with black text). Avoid low-contrast pairings like dark blue on black. Fonts should be bold, blocky, and sans-serif (e.g., Impact, Arial Black, Franklin Gothic). Avoid script or thin serif fonts, as they are difficult to read at a distance or in poor light. For morale patches, color palettes can be more vibrant, but remember that very bright colors might not be suitable for all tactical environments. Consider colorfastness as well; colors should resist fading from sun exposure and repeated cleaning.
Incorporating relevant symbols and imagery
Symbols and imagery should be meaningful and simple. For official identification, stick to authorized unit insignia or flags. For medical patches, use universally recognized symbols like the Red Cross (note: its use may be legally restricted in some regions), Star of Life, or a caduceus for medical personnel. For custom designs, simplify logos to their core elements. Fine details, thin lines, and subtle gradients do not translate well to embroidery or woven patches. A good rule is that the design should be recognizable even when reduced to a 1-inch icon. Always vectorize your artwork for manufacturing to ensure crisp, clean edges at any size.
Considerations for readability and visibility
Every design decision should be filtered through the lens of readability and visibility. Ask yourself: Can this be read from 10 feet away in twilight? Key factors include:
- Text Size: Ensure letters are tall enough. A minimum height of 0.5 inches for critical text is a good benchmark.
- Spacing: Adequate spacing between letters (kerning) and lines (leading) prevents visual crowding.
- Background Contrast: As emphasized, this is the most critical factor for legibility.
- Symbol Clarity: Symbols should be bold and not overly intricate.
Common patch materials (e.g., embroidered, PVC, woven)
The material defines the patch's look, feel, and durability.
| Material | Description | Best For | Pros | Cons |
|---|---|---|---|---|
| Embroidered | Thread stitched onto a fabric base (usually twill). | Identification patches, unit insignia, professional logos. | Classic, professional look; durable; breathable; excellent color retention. | Not ideal for highly detailed designs or small text; raised texture. |
| PVC / Rubber | Molded from soft Polyvinyl Chloride or silicone rubber. | Morale patches, 3D designs, waterproof applications. | Vibrant colors; excellent detail reproduction; waterproof and easy to clean; modern look. | Can be stiff; less breathable; may crack in extreme cold. |
| Woven | Fine threads woven together on a jacquard loom. | Patches with very fine detail, small text, or photographic imagery. | Superior detail and resolution; flat, smooth profile; lightweight. | Less textured/3D look; can be less durable than heavy embroidery if snagged. |
| Printed/Dye Sublimated | Ink printed directly onto fabric. | Full-color photographic images, complex gradients. | Unlimited colors and photorealistic designs; cost-effective for small runs. | Prone to fading from UV exposure and abrasion; less traditional "tactical" feel. |
Velcro backing options and durability
The backing is what secures the patch to the carrier. The standard is "hook" backing (the rough side) sewn or laminated onto the patch, which attaches to the "loop" panel (the soft side) on the vest. Quality is paramount. Military-grade Velcro (such as Mil-Spec VELCRO® Brand) uses tighter weaves and stronger adhesives. For high-durability applications, consider:
- Stitched Border: The hook material is sewn onto the patch fabric, preventing peeling.
- Laminated/Glued: The hook is adhered with strong glue. Good for PVC patches but can fail under heat or heavy stress.
- Loop Backing: Less common, but some patches come with loop backing to attach to hook panels.
Manufacturing processes: pros and cons
The manufacturing process is tied to the material. Embroidery uses computerized machines that guide needles to create the design with thread. PVC patches are created by injecting liquid PVC into metal molds. Woven patches are produced on computerized looms. The choice involves trade-offs between detail, texture, cost, and minimum order quantity (MOQ). Embroidery has a moderate MOQ and is cost-effective for standard designs. PVC has a higher setup cost for the mold but then low per-unit costs, ideal for large orders of complex morale patches. Woven patches have a high setup cost and are best for ultra-detailed designs in medium to large quantities. Dye sublimation is excellent for low-MQ, full-color prototypes but lacks the durability for long-term field use.
Quality control and lifespan of patches
A quality patch should withstand rigorous use. Key quality indicators include tight, dense stitching (no loose threads), cleanly cut edges (merrowed border on embroidered patches), vibrant and colorfast dyes, and securely attached Velcro. The lifespan depends on material, use, and care. A well-made embroidered patch on a plate carrier can last for years of regular use. PVC patches are highly durable but can degrade with prolonged UV exposure. Woven patches are durable but can snag. To maximize lifespan, follow care instructions, avoid harsh chemicals, and inspect patches regularly for signs of wear on the Velcro or fabric. Rotating between multiple sets of patches can also extend their life.

Factors to consider when choosing a vendor (price, quality, turnaround time)
Selecting a vendor requires balancing three core factors:
- Price: Get quotes from multiple vendors. Low price can indicate inferior materials (cheap, fuzzy Velcro that loses grip) or poor craftsmanship. Remember, this is life-saving equipment, not a souvenir.
- Quality: This is paramount. Request material samples. Ask about their stitch density (e.g., stitches per inch), type of thread (polyester is superior to rayon), and Velcro brand. A reputable vendor will be transparent about their specifications.
- Turnaround Time: Includes production time and shipping. Standard turnaround is 2-4 weeks. Rush services are available at a premium. For operations in Hong Kong with urgent needs, a local vendor might offer a significant time advantage over an overseas one, despite a potentially higher cost.
Proper attachment techniques to ensure secure placement
Attachment seems simple, but doing it correctly ensures the patch stays secure. First, ensure the plate carrier's loop panel is clean and free of debris. Align the patch (with its hook backing) carefully. Press firmly across the entire surface, not just the center, to engage all the hooks. For critical identification patches, some operators apply a very small amount of hook-and-loop compatible adhesive (like Velcro Brand Stick Fast) to the back of the patch for added security during extreme activities, though this makes removal harder. Periodically check that the patch hasn't curled at the edges, which is a sign of failing Velcro or improper initial attachment.
Cleaning and care instructions to prolong patch life
Most patches can be hand-washed or spot-cleaned. For embroidered and woven patches, use mild soap and lukewarm water. Gently scrub with a soft brush, rinse thoroughly, and air dry flat. Do not wring or twist. For PVC patches, they can often be wiped clean with a damp cloth and mild detergent. Avoid machine washing and drying, as the tumbling action can fray edges and degrade the Velcro backing. Never use bleach, strong solvents, or iron directly on the patch, as this can melt threads (especially PVC) or fade colors. For the loop panel on the vest, use a Velcro comb or a stiff brush to remove lint and debris that can reduce the hook's grip.
Avoiding damage and fading
The primary enemies of patches are physical abrasion, ultraviolet (UV) light, and harsh chemicals. To avoid damage:
- Store gear out of direct sunlight when not in use.
- Avoid dragging the plate carrier over rough surfaces.
- Be mindful of patches snagging on vehicle interiors, wire fences, or brush.
- Remove patches before applying insect repellent or sunscreen to the vest, as DEET and certain chemicals can degrade fabrics and colors.
Regulations regarding patches on official uniforms
This is a critical and often overlooked area. Military, law enforcement, and many government agencies have strict uniform regulations governing the size, placement, content, and even material of patches. In the Hong Kong Police Force, for example, the wearing of identification and unit patches is precisely specified in dress regulations. Unauthorized patches can result in disciplinary action. Even in private security, company policies may dictate what can be displayed. Always consult the relevant rules and regulations (ROE) or standard operating procedures (SOP) before designing and deploying custom patches. When in doubt, seek approval from the chain of command or management.
Avoiding copyrighted or offensive designs
Intellectual property and decorum matter. Using copyrighted logos, characters from movies/video games, or trademarked symbols without permission is illegal and can lead to legal action from the rights holder. Similarly, avoid designs that could be considered offensive, discriminatory, or politically inflammatory. This includes imagery related to extremist groups, profane language, or symbols that could be misinterpreted in a multicultural environment like Hong Kong. A good practice is to create original artwork or use symbols that are in the public domain. If you must use a licensed design, obtain written permission. This protects you, your team, and your employer from potential legal and reputational harm.

Examples of patches used in various professions (military, law enforcement, security)
- Military: Standardized name tapes, blood type, flag patches (often reversed on the right shoulder as per U.S. tradition), unit insignia, and qualification badges (Airborne, Ranger tab). Morale patches are worn in garrison or in permissive environments.
- Law Enforcement (Hong Kong Example): The Hong Kong Police Tactical Unit (PTU) and Special Duties Unit (SDU) use specific unit patches and call-sign identifiers. Patrol officers may have reflective identification patches for traffic duty.
- Private Security: Patches typically feature the company logo, "SECURITY" designation, and an individual ID number. For close protection teams, patches can be very discreet or even removable to maintain a low profile.
- Search and Rescue (SAR): Often use high-visibility reflective patches with "SAR" and their team designation, sometimes incorporating a map grid or coordinate system reference.
